Your Mess
You will need: cones & a selection of balls
- Split the PE area into 2 equal areas. divide the balls between both sides.
- Divide the class into two groups.
- On the whistle, students try to roll all the balls out of their half into the other teams half - Students must only roll the balls.
- After 1 minute, the teacher blows the whistle to stop. The winning team has the least number of balls on their side.
- Reset the balls and repeat a number of times.
Obstacle Course
You will need: obstacle course mapping cards, cones, hoops, spot markers, skipping ropes, beanbags, racket, balls, hurdles etc.
- Create teams of 5-7 and give each team a course card to follow.
- Layout the equipment needed for the course cards.
- Allow 5 minutes for course creation and practice.
- After 5 minutes each group explains and demonstrates their obstacle course.
- Rotate the groups around the courses, allowing each group to complete others designs.

Stone Statue
You will need: no equipment
- Students find their own space in the PE area.
- Students move around the space using any movements they like at a fast speed.
- After a short amount of time the teacher 'casts a spell.'
- Students must begin to slowly to turn to stone. Students movements get slower, and more 'difficult' as they gradually turn to stone.
